Lexus issues stop-sale, recall on LS 460 and LS 600h

True predictions, The Detroit News reporting that Lexus has issued a stop sale its LS 460 and LS 600h (standard and long-wheelbase) luxury sedans due a problem electronic steering system that can temporarily cause steering wheel become off-centered. Apparently, wheel will return its correct position after about five seconds misalignment. Toyota issued a recall Friday, May 21st address defect. Although Toyota has reportedly fixed the problem on new models rolling down the assembly lines in Japan, those recalibrated machines not expected to hit dealership lots in America until the middle June. In the meantime, the 3,800 or so owners affected 2009 and 2010 LS sedans being urged to avoid turning the steering wheel rapidly after holding it in full lock in the opposite direction.

We would imagine that there are certain scenarios where following such advice may prove difficult to follow, but Toyota so far reporting that no injuries or accidents have been caused by the issue.
